Quote:
Originally Posted by FerrariEnzo View Post
theres prolly a catch.. when things are too good to be true, then they are not...
prolly things like buy the sim or buy the phone from them outright without being on the windtab or something..
I don't think there is a catch other than the monthly or bi-yearly topups, you just need to activate a prepaid line with them and add the Social Blackberry add-on for $5/month.

You'll need to either top up $10 every month, $40 every 6 months, or $100/year to keep the line active.
